Output e1ec54b660d5149b478f5741c63bd7cb91ffd61bcee2a524db8ef3579f967e20:3

value
160598
script pubkey
OP_0 OP_PUSHBYTES_20 3abac680fe1f8c939da23e5c8aa10efd4170a029
address
bc1q82avdq87r7xf88dz8ewg4ggwl4qhpgpfpwqu8m
transaction
e1ec54b660d5149b478f5741c63bd7cb91ffd61bcee2a524db8ef3579f967e20